| <p>Contains the backup and restore functionality available to |
| applications. If a user wipes the data on their device or upgrades to a new Android-powered |
| device, all applications that have enabled backup can restore the user's previous data when the |
| application is reinstalled.</p> |

| <p>All backup and restore operations are controlled by the {@link |
| android.app.backup.BackupManager}. Each application that would |
| like to enable backup and preserve its data on remote strage must implement a |
| backup agent. A backup agent can be built by extending either {@link android.app.backup.BackupAgent} |
| or {@link android.app.backup.BackupAgentHelper}. The {@link |
| android.app.backup.BackupAgentHelper} class provides a wrapper around {@link |
| android.app.backup.BackupAgent} that simplifies the procedures to implement a backup agent by |
| employing backup helpers such as {@link android.app.backup.SharedPreferencesBackupHelper} and |
| {@link android.app.backup.FileBackupHelper}.</p> |
| |
| <p>The backup APIs let applications:</p> |
| <ul> |
| <li>Perform backup of arbitrary data to remote storage</li> |
| <li>Easily perform backup of {@link android.content.SharedPreferences} and files</li> |
| <li>Restore the data saved to remote storage</li> |
| </ul> |
